Hi, What graphics card are you using. It is possible that the windows install changed some hw settings for it. As an example, I can mention that when I enabled AGP fast write for my nvidia card, it failed to start, and when I changed the setting back, it worked again. I decided to try Win XP last night on my machine, the one running SuSE 7.2. Well I formatted my HDD (SuSE is on another HDD) and installed, everything on the XP side went fine, but as waited for X to start it failed. I seem at this point that is all the problems I'm having.
Has anyone got an idea what might have happened? I'm not too worried yet I just plan to re-install X and hope that solves the problem.
Really I figured that if SuSE was on a separated HDD it would be safe from the evil windows, guessed wrong. Guess I should have unplugged the IDE cable just to be sure.
